Factors Influencing macOS Update Duration

The time it takes to update macOS can vary widely depending on several critical factors. Understanding these variables can help set realistic expectations and prepare for the update process more effectively.

One major factor is the type of update being installed. Updates can range from minor security patches and bug fixes to major operating system upgrades. Smaller updates generally require less time because they involve fewer system changes and smaller files. Conversely, full version upgrades often need more time due to larger downloads and more complex installation procedures.

Another significant factor is the speed of your internet connection. Since macOS updates are downloaded from Apple’s servers, slower internet speeds will increase the download time. This aspect is especially important for large updates, which can be several gigabytes in size.

The performance of your Mac hardware also plays a crucial role. Older Macs with slower processors, less RAM, or traditional hard drives (HDD) may take longer to complete the installation compared to newer models equipped with solid-state drives (SSD) and more powerful CPUs.

Background processes and available storage space can impact update speed as well. If your Mac is low on free space, the update may take longer or even fail, as the system needs room to unpack and install files. Additionally, running many applications or processes during the update can slow down the procedure.

Typical Time Estimates for macOS Updates

While exact times can vary, the following table provides a general overview of how long different types of macOS updates usually take under average conditions:

Update Type Download Size Estimated Download Time* (at 100 Mbps) Estimated Installation Time Total Time Estimate
Minor Security & Bug Fixes 100-500 MB 1-5 minutes 5-15 minutes 6-20 minutes
Incremental Feature Updates 500 MB – 2 GB 5-20 minutes 15-30 minutes 20-50 minutes
Major macOS Version Upgrades 3-12 GB 10-60 minutes 30-90 minutes 40-150 minutes

*Download time varies significantly with internet speed; 100 Mbps is used as a reference.

Steps to Optimize macOS Update Speed

There are several practical steps users can take to help ensure their macOS updates complete as quickly and smoothly as possible:

  • Check Internet Connection: Use a stable and fast Wi-Fi network or a wired Ethernet connection to reduce download time.
  • Free Up Disk Space: Ensure at least 15-20% of your disk is free before starting the update to avoid installation slowdowns or errors.
  • Close Unnecessary Applications: Shut down background apps and processes that may consume CPU or disk resources.
  • Update During Off-Peak Hours: Apple’s servers may be busy during peak times (e.g., right after a major update release), so updating during less busy times can improve download speeds.
  • Keep Your Mac Powered: Connect your Mac to power during the update to prevent interruptions due to battery depletion.

What Happens During the macOS Update Process

The macOS update process typically involves several stages, each with different time requirements:

  • Preparation: The system verifies the downloaded update, checks compatibility, and prepares files for installation. This phase can take several minutes depending on system performance.
  • Installation: The update is applied to the system. Your Mac may restart multiple times. During this stage, the screen may display a progress bar or status messages.
  • Post-installation: Once the core installation is complete, the system performs cleanup tasks, updates system caches, and applies final configurations. This phase may require the Mac to be idle but can also involve user input if necessary.

The overall update experience depends on the efficiency of these steps and the hardware’s ability to process them quickly.

Potential Delays and Troubleshooting Tips

Sometimes macOS updates take longer than expected or appear to stall. Common causes include:

  • Slow or Interrupted Internet: If the download pauses or fails, restarting the update or switching networks may help.
  • Insufficient Storage: The update may halt if there isn’t enough free space; deleting unnecessary files can resolve this.
  • Hardware Limitations: Older Macs with slower processors or HDDs naturally take longer.
  • Software Conflicts: Third-party security software or system utilities may interfere with the update process.
  • Corrupt Download: If the update file is corrupted, deleting and re-downloading the update can fix the issue.

If an update seems stuck for more than several hours, it may be necessary to restart the Mac or seek support from Apple’s troubleshooting resources.
